Taurus is shaking up the revolver game with their latest brainchild: a dual-cylinder Deputy SAO revolver chambered in .357 Magnum/.38 Special *and* 9mm Luger. Picture this—a hefty wheelgun tipping the scales at over 40 ounces, built for single-action-only fun that lets you swap cylinders like changing outfits for a range day. It’s not just another rimfire plinker; this beast launches full-powered 9x19mm Parabellum from a revolver platform, delivering that satisfying boom without the brass-flinging drama of semi-autos.
